Data centers need to store and deliver the highest-value data quickly, consistently and reliably. The Pulsar XT.2 SSD was designed for the enterprise and provides the ultra-fast speed and highest endurance that write-intensive, Tier 0 applications need.- Consistent high performance for complex, I/O intensive, mixed workload enterprise environments
- Fastest random write performance available in a small form factor, SAS-based SSD (18% higher than the closest competitor)
- Ultra-high endurance (supports over 35 full drive writes per day (25 petabytes written lifetime)
- Advanced media-management technology helps protect against unexpected data change or loss
- 6Gb/s SAS interface for scalability and reliability
- 2.5-inch form factor fits existing HDD slots
- Hotpluggable to avoid unnecessary downtime
- Common storage foundation reduces system complexity and operating overhead
- World-class service, fulfillment and reliability
- Self-Encrypting Drive (SED) option helps companies be compliant with data security mandates and helps protect data at rest throughout the life of the storage device
